Headlines frequently celebrate the brilliant new AI models and the innovators who create them. However, a quieter, yet powerful, force has been powering this revolution from beneath the surface: CoreWeave. 

Founded in 2017 in New Jersey by former commodities traders Michael Intrator, Brian Venturo, Brannin McBee, and Peter Salanki, the company began as Atlantic Crypto, mining Ethereum with GPU rigs. When the crypto market crashed, CoreWeave made a strategic pivot in 2019. It successfully transformed its GPU arsenal into a high-performance cloud infrastructure specifically tailored for accelerated computing workloads.

By late 2024 and into 2025, CoreWeave had become a cornerstone of the AI ecosystem. Its deep ties to NVIDIA, massive partnerships with top developers, and technical architecture purpose-built for compute-intensive tasks mean CoreWeave is not simply keeping pace—it is setting the tempo for the future of AI infrastructure.

The Bottleneck: Why AI Needs Specialized Cloud Infrastructure

Developing and deploying advanced AI, particularly Large Language Models (LLMs) and complex machine learning algorithms, requires an unimaginable amount of computational power. This essential power comes primarily from Graphics Processing Units (GPUs), which are uniquely suited for the parallel processing tasks that make AI workloads thrive.

Crucially, accessing this compute at the necessary scale remains a significant challenge for most companies. This bottleneck can be broken down into three core issues:

The Triad of Core Challenges

  • Scarcity: High-end AI GPUs, such as the NVIDIA H100 and newer chips, are in extremely high demand and often in short supply globally.
  • Cost: Owning and meticulously maintaining massive GPU clusters proves prohibitively expensive for all but the largest tech giants.
  • Complexity: Setting up, optimizing, and expertly managing these specialized hardware environments requires deep, specialized technical expertise.

CoreWeave: GPU Cloud, Reimagined for Accelerated Computing

CoreWeave is fundamentally distinct from a general-purpose cloud provider. Furthermore, it operates as a specialized cloud provider, focusing almost exclusively on GPU compute for AI/ML workloads. Their focused approach yields superior results and efficiency for clients.

Solving the Compute Crisis with Specialization

CoreWeave’s specialization allows it to deliver superior performance for demanding AI tasks. Their key offerings and partnerships effectively address the industry's compute shortage:

  • Massive GPU Clusters: They provide access to vast pools of high-performance GPUs, primarily leveraging NVIDIA’s cutting-edge hardware. For instance, their infrastructure can deliver up to 20% higher Model FLOPS Utilization (MFU) on large clusters compared to alternatives, significantly accelerating the training of frontier models.
  • Strategic NVIDIA Partnership: The relationship with NVIDIA goes beyond a customer-supplier dynamic; NVIDIA is a key shareholder. Most recently, the companies signed a $6.3 billion strategic capacity agreement through 2032, wherein NVIDIA committed to buying any unsold cloud capacity. This provides CoreWeave with a powerful financial backstop and guaranteed demand.
  • OpenAI’s Compute Commitment: OpenAI has dramatically expanded its deal with CoreWeave, bringing the total value of its capacity agreements to a staggering $22.4 billion as of late 2025. This monumental contract solidifies CoreWeave’s position as a crucial infrastructure partner for one of the world's leading AI labs.

The Strategic Importance and Explosive Growth

CoreWeave’s meteoric rise, marked by soaring valuations and significant funding rounds, underscores its strategic importance. They are directly solving the most pressing issue for AI companies: reliable, powerful access to GPU compute.

Solidifying a Core Position in the Ecosystem

Unlike hyperscale cloud providers (like AWS or Azure) that offer a vast array of generalized services, CoreWeave’s singular focus on GPU compute allows for superior optimization and better cost-efficiency for AI-specific workloads. Thus, this enables smaller AI startups and research labs to compete effectively with larger, established players, fostering a more diverse and innovative landscape. The massive financial commitments from industry leaders confirm their vital role:

  • NVIDIA’s Financial Backstop: The $6.3 billion capacity pact through 2032 eliminates the risk of unsold capacity for CoreWeave, ensuring predictable revenue and cementing the company as an essential extension of NVIDIA's market presence.
  • The OpenAI Commitment: The $22.4 billion agreement secures the compute needed for OpenAI’s most advanced next-generation models. Furthermore, this deal diversifies CoreWeave's client base, reducing its historical dependency on clients like Microsoft Azure.
